Dear Praveen, yes ofcourse you can do M.E/M.Tech in Avionics. M-Tech/M.E in Avionics is also known as Masters in Aeronautical Engineering. The course enables the candidate to explore in depth the field of study concerning aircraft structural components and focuses on developing talented engineers in the field of new aircraft technologies and business management skills.
The duration of M-Tech Avionics is 2 years, which is divided into 4 semesters. Candidates can get admission to this course through GATE in some colleges like IIT Madras, Mumbai etc., and through entrance exams in other private colleges. Candidates with a first-class bachelors degree in Aeronautical Engineering, Electrical Sciences etc. may apply for the same.
Major organisations like TCS, Mahindra, DRDO, ISRO etc. hire these students and the average salary for avionic engineers ranges between INR 35,000 to 50,000 per month.
